This introduction to international economics presents the relevant
theory rigorously but accessibly and relies mainly on diagrammatic
techniques, not mathematics. It covers trade theory and policy,
including recent work on imperfect competition. There are chapters
on the history of trade policy and topical issues such as NEOPHYTE,
reforms in Eastern Europe, and the growing use of non-tariff
barriers. Kenen also covers international monetary theory and
policy, focusing on payments adjustment under fixed and floating
exchange rates, the functioning of monetary and fiscal policies in
open economies, and the effects of expectations on exchange-rate
behaviour. There are chapters on the evolution of the monetary
system and on current issues such as policy coordination and
European monetary union. Kenen devotes special attention to the
assumptions underlying basic propositions and covers policy issues
extensively.
This paperback edition consists of the first three parts of Allen
and Kenen's major book, Asset Markets, Exchange Rates, and Economic
Integration. These three parts stand alone, as the authors intended
and as reviewers have commented. In parts four and five of that
volume they extend their model to two countries trading with the
outside world and analyze questions of economic integration. The
authors synthesize and extend recent developments in international
monetary theory using a general model of an open economy that
trades goods and assets with the outside world. The model embodies
the asset market or portfolio approach to analyzing
balance-of-payments adjustment. Exchange rates are determined in
the short run by conditions in the asset markets and in the long
run by conditions in the goods markets. The goods markets include
an export good, and import good, and a nontradeable good. Allen and
Kenen show that different assumptions about the substitutability
between goods or between assets can generate several popular models
as special cases of their own.
